Transaction 43850566d709f7efcde6e4b99f62b118ea3c2e2832fb9a49344b436f66fa9c15
1 Input
2 Outputs
- 43850566d709f7efcde6e4b99f62b118ea3c2e2832fb9a49344b436f66fa9c15:0
- 43850566d709f7efcde6e4b99f62b118ea3c2e2832fb9a49344b436f66fa9c15:1
value 39464504
address 2N32gmLa2S2GaDMXTcd5hV3Ecxe7MA8nvET
value 0
address